Rajnikanth has come back after a long exile from his illness. He had been hospitalised in singapore following an attack of allergic bronchitis. After recovering from his illness, did a cameo in Shah Rukh Khan’s Ra-one. And now he is all set to appear in a government ad campaign against malnutrition.
A recent study stated that the mortality rate among Indian children is high due to malnutrition, which is why the government decided to spread awareness on the subject through an ad campaign. Sources say that Aamir Khan has also been roped in for the initiative, which will advocate the eradication of malnutrition. Not only will banners of the stars campaigning for the cause be put up across the nation, but the duo will also participate in promotions throughout the country.
Though Rajinikanth has refrained from doing commercials, he agreed to this campaign as it deals with an issue that concerns the welfare of the people.
Not to forget, in the 80s, Rajni participated in an Ad campaign to eradicate polio. !!!
